🥘 Ingredients

10 items
  • 4 pieces Pork chops
  • 1 cup Almond flour
  • 1 cup Gr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 large Eggs
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on On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on Paprika
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 4 tablespoons Olive oil

📝 Instructions

11 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).

2

In a shallow dish, mix together the almond flour, parmesan cheese, gar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and black pepper.

3

In another shallow bowl, beat the eggs until well mixed.

4

Pat the pork chops dry with paper towels to remove excess moisture. This will help the coating stick better.

5

Dip each pork chop into the beaten eggs, ensuring both sides are well-coated.

6

Press each egg-coated pork chop into the almond flour mixture, turning to coat both sides thoroughly. Press gently so the coating adheres well.

7

In a large oven-safe skillet, heat the olive oil over medium-high heat.

8

Once the oil is hot, add the breaded pork chops and cook for approximately 2-3 minutes on each side, or until the coating is golden brown.

9

Transfer the skillet with the pork chops to the preheated oven and bake for 12-15 minutes, or until the internal temperature of the pork reaches 145°F (63°C).

10

Remove the pork chops from the oven and let them rest for 5 minutes before serving to allow the juices to redistribute.

11

Serve warm, paired with your choice of keto-friendly sides such as sautéed vegetables or a fresh green salad.
